  • Wandle Housing Association is looking for a proactive, organised and customer-focused

Business Support Administrator to join our Health, Safety & Facilities team.

As the first point of contact for visitors, you’ll play a key role in creating a professional first impression while providing vital administrative and facilities support to colleagues across the organisation.

This role would suit someone with reception, front of house, concierge or customer service experience who enjoys working in a busy office environment.

  • What You’ll Be Doing
  • Providing a professional front of house and reception service.
  • Welcoming visitors, issuing security passes and managing meeting rooms.
  • Delivering excellent customer service to internal and external stakeholders.
  • Supporting the business with a variety of administrative tasks, including occasional minute taking.
  • Managing post, office supplies and stock levels.
  • Supporting Health & Safety and Facilities activities, including office inspections and liaising with contractors.
  • Acting as a First Aider and Fire Warden (training provided if required).
  • What We’re Looking For

Essential

  • Front of house, reception or concierge experience (office experience preferred, but other customer-facing sectors welcome).
  • Excellent customer service skills and a professional, approachable manner.
  • Strong organisational skills and the 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• 5 GCSEs (or equivalent), including English.
  • First Aid at Work qualification or willingness to complete the training.

Housing sector experience would be an advantage but is not essential. We’re happy to consider candidates with around

6 months to 2 years’ experience .
